【竺】Postman实操3

使用postman进行简单压力测试

    目录

    • 1、新建一个fodder,在fodder下添加要进行压力测试的接口:

    • 2、post接口测试,参数从txt导入

    • 3、设置 Pre-request-Script 参数

    • 4、设置test(便于观察测试结果)

    • 5、保存请求,点击runner,按如下设置

    • 6、设置Iteration

    • 7、测试结果

  • 参考:

返回目录

postman使用

开发中经常用postman来测试接口,一个简单的注册接口用postman测试:

接口正常工作只是最基本的要求,经常要评估接口性能,进行压力测试。

返回目录

postman进行简单压力测试

下面是压测数据源,支持json和csv两个格式,如果包含有中文,请将文件编码改为UTF-8(否则请求中文会乱码)

csv格式数据如下(txt文件):

json格式如下:

[ {'registerName': 'zhangsan0001','registerPwd': 'asd100001'}, {'registerName': 'zhangsan0002','registerPwd': 'asd100002'}, {'registerName': 'zhangsan0003','registerPwd': 'asd100003'}, {'registerName': 'zhangsan0004','registerPwd': 'asd100004'}, {'registerName': 'zhangsan0005','registerPwd': 'asd100005'} ]

以csv格式数据为例(json格式数据只需要在导入测试数据时,选择json就可以):

返回目录

1、新建一个fodder,在fodder下添加要进行压力测试的接口:

返回目录

2、post接口测试,参数从txt导入

{{registerName}} 和 {{registerPwd}} 是模板参数

返回目录

3、设置 Pre-request-Script 参数

postman.setEnvironmentVariable('registerName',data['registerName']);
postman.setEnvironmentVariable('registerPwd',data['registerPwd']);

返回目录

4、设置test(便于观察测试结果)

tests['Status code is 200'] = responseCode.code === 200;
tests['Response time is less than 10000ms'] = responseTime < 10000;
console.log(responseTime);

返回目录

5、保存请求,点击runner,按如下设置

Delay:设置每隔多少毫秒发一次请求。

Data File Type 选择 CSV,点击预览可以看到:

返回目录

6、设置Iteration

预览Iteration一共有359行,设置Iteration为 359 ,点击Run

返回目录

7、测试结果

postman跑完全部测试用例,按test给出了测试结果:

返回目录

参考:

(0)

相关推荐

  • OpenLDAP 最详细的概念教程

    OpenLDAP 轻型目录访问协议(英文:Lightweight Directory Access Protocol,缩写:LDAP)是一个开放的,中立的,工业标准的应用协议,通过IP协议提供访问控制 ...

  • 【竺】Postman实操2

    Postman进阶实践:获取天气预报实例 更新注意 : 1.这个网站的接口增加注册给出了appid和app密码访问时要注意看接口文档 免费版接口: https://tianqiapi.com/free ...

  • 【竺】Postman实操1

    【竺】Postman实操1

  • 【竺】数据库笔记10——视图3实操

    多表视图: 创建视图: CREATE VIEW grade AS SELECT c.coursename,sc.studentNo,s.`name`,sc.score FROM courses as ...

  • 徐州工程二级造价实操培训班推荐哪家好

    熟悉招标文件的图纸 这个时候要注意的就是有没有比较少见的材料及工艺,如果有,应该尽快准备好其材料价格或分包价格. 2搜集材料价格主要是大宗材料.如商品砼及钢筋.水泥的价格(注意考虑税的因素),砖块的价 ...

  • 研发人员薪酬设计实操指南

    Part 1 研发人员管理场景 如果你仔细观察公司研发人员,你有可能会发现下列现象: 1.研发人员只对承担的项目负责,对其他人的事情毫不关心: 2.研发部门凭印象和感觉增加工资: 3.公司想重点培育的 ...

  • 冷阳关东冷四针实操演示

    冷阳关东冷四针实操演示

  • 网购兰花买到激素苗怎么养护?做到这4点实操技巧,激素苗也不怕

    今天有网友问到,网购兰花的根呈黄黑色,根尖无水晶头又发黑是怎么回事?是否为肥害,有什么后期补救措施? 敲重点:网购的兰花根系呈黄黑色,根尖无水晶头且发黑,这不是肥害,不是肥害,不是肥害,而是典型的激素 ...

  • 财务高手怎样判断数据是否异常?(实操版)

    版权声明 本文来源于:审计之家(ID:sj20130516)微信公众号 导言 财务部究竟如何判断自己每天要看的数据是否异常? 有一天,我正在极其认真地研究一份财务报告,忽然听到背后老大幽幽的一句:看这 ...

  • 「食环药辩护」邓楚开、谢蓓:污染环境类案件辩护实操

    污染环境类案件辩护实操--以某被控污染环境案辩护经验为范例的分析 本文通过分享自己办理个案的经历,以解剖一只麻雀的方式,具体介绍拿到一个污染环境刑事案件后,怎么进行辩护. 本案是发生在浙江省某县的一起 ...